Ethiopian Limmu coffee
Ethiopian Limmu coffee is a high-quality coffee variety grown in the Limmu region of Ethiopia. The coffee plants are grown at an altitude of 1,300 to 2,000 meters above sea level, which provides ideal growing conditions for this Arabica coffee variety. The harvest period for Ethiopian Limmu coffee is from October to February.
The Limmu region is located in the western part of Ethiopia and is known for its unique coffee growing conditions. The region’s high altitude, fertile soil, and consistent rainfall provide ideal conditions for coffee growth.
The body of Ethiopian Limmu coffee is medium to full-bodied, with a smooth and rich texture. The acidity is bright and lively, providing a balanced and refreshing taste. The flavor profile is complex, with notes of fruit and chocolate that are balanced by a subtle earthiness. The aroma of Ethiopian Limmu coffee is sweet and floral, with a hint of spice.
The milling process for Ethiopian Limmu coffee involves washing the beans to remove the outer husk and then sun-drying the beans. This traditional method is known as the “washed” process and results in a clean and bright flavor profile.
